Google meets the neighbors and gets both barrels over its new UK datacenter
EXCLUSIVE Google invited residents living near its newly built datacenter north of London to meet the team at the local council offices on Wednesday evening – and was met with a barrage of complaints about poor consultation, noise, and light pollution. The Waltham Cross Datacenter (WXT), which was officially opened last year, sits on a 33-acre (133,546 m²) site north of the M25 motorway that encircles London.
